Begin with regular maintenance. One of the most effective ways to ensure your air conditioning system is running efficiently is by scheduling regular maintenance check-ups. These check-ups should include cleaning or replacing filters every one to three months, depending on the usage and type of filter. Dirty filters can obstruct airflow and significantly reduce the efficiency of the system, causing it to work harder than necessary.
Next, pay attention to your thermostat settings. Programming your thermostat to a higher temperature when you are away from home can lead to substantial energy savings. A smart thermostat can make this adjustment automatically, providing convenience and optimizing cooling based on your schedule. Keeping the thermostat set at around 78 degrees Fahrenheit when you're home and awake is generally recommended for balancing comfort and energy consumption.
Ensure your home is properly insulated. Good insulation helps to keep the cool air inside and the hot air out, reducing the load on your air conditioning system. Check areas like attics, walls, and basements for adequate insulation and seal any leaks or cracks that could allow warm air to infiltrate or cooled air to escape.
Think about using ceiling fans to supplement your cooling system. While they do not cool a room, ceiling fans can create a wind-chill effect that helps people feel cooler. By running a ceiling fan in occupied rooms, you can raise the thermostat setting by about 4 degrees without reducing comfort, thereby enhancing your air conditioning system’s efficiency.
Rearrange furniture to ensure air flows freely through the room. Blocked vents can reduce the cooling efficiency and increase the work for your system. Ensuring that air vents are not blocked by furniture or drapes will help your system operate more efficiently, pushing cool air throughout the house with ease.
Consider upgrading to an energy-efficient model if your air conditioner is more than 10-15 years old. Newer models are significantly more efficient and can offer a return on investment in terms of energy savings. Look for units with a high SEER (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io) rating to ensure you are getting the best efficiency for your needs.
